    This is the MAN D2066 LUH Engine series for the DT40L

    It comes with 5 power ratings from 310HP to 420HP, custom sounds, realistic torque curves, and data recorded by me that has been used for the engine dynamics





    Video demonstrating the engine


    Engine torque curves for power ratings
    vlc_RLcNI4wMod.png vlc_tgdvh9zaOZ.png vlc_k7biY7gIHZ.png


    Its a close as possible as I can get it. I divided the torque values from the spec sheet by half, and then used the turbo to make up for the lost power. This is how I got the different power ratings while still having a turbo that pushes a lot of boost even at the lowest power


    I recorded my own data for this mod, which was idle, redline, kickdown and shifting RPM. I also tried to match the interior sound as good as possible and got pretty close. I tried to match the shifting of the 604 to what it is in real life, in a MAN 18.310 bus, as thats the one that I based this mod off


    This engine is best used with a ZF Ecomat 6HP-604/C transmission from my other mod, the Wentward Transmission Pack, with a 310hp turbo for maximum realism, as thats the config that I based this off. It can also be realistically used with the Voith DiWA 864.5 gearbox with a 320hp turbo, as it is in real life too.
    But this is BeamNG.drive, so do whatever you want! Theres no limits!
